In Memoriam: Dr. Walter Kwok

The HKBU Foundation records with deepest sorrow the passing of Dr. Walter Kwok Ping Sheung, JP, donor of HKBU, on 20 October 2018. He was 69 years old.
Dr. Kwok, founder of Empire Group Holdings Limited and former chairman and chief executive of Sun Hung Kai Properties Limited, was a Hong Kong property magnate who had made remarkable contributions to the real estate and property construction industry through his passion and visionary leadership. He was appointed Justice of the Peace in 1995.
Dr. Kwok was not only a prominent entrepreneur but also a well respected philanthropist. He founded the Walter Kwok Foundation and the Kwok Scholars Association to support various charitable activities. Being especially devoted to educational causes, he set up the Kwok Scholarship Programme to help students who have demonstrated a strong commitment to public service study at top tier universities such as the University of Oxford and Yale University. He also made donations to charities such as the Foodlink Foundation and Suicide Prevention Services, thereby giving a hand to the underprivileged. A staunch supporter of HKBU, Dr. Kwok made generous donations in support of the University’s institutional advancement and the construction of the David C. Lam Building.
